Richmond Pearson Hamby Jr 1943 - 2012

Richmond Pearson Hamby Jr was born on May 15, 1943, and died at age 69 years old on October 25, 2012. Richmond Hamby was buried at Florida National Cemetery Section 3A Row 1B Site 9 6502 Sw. 102nd Ave., in Bushnell, Fl. In 1943, in the year that Richmond Pearson Hamby Jr was born, on September 3rd, the Armistice of Cassibile was signed in Sicily. Under the terms of the Armistice, Italy surrendered to the Allied Powers. After the Armistice was made public on September 8th, Germany attacked and occupied Italy. It took 20 months of fighting for the Allies to reach the northern borders of Italy.
